The AR experience at cartier

It’s beyond exciting to see how Augmented Reality is revolutionizing the luxury brand experience at Cartier. The jewellery line which was established in 1847, is moving forward with the use of technology by breaking the norm. Cartier has partnered up with the software developers Jolibrain and Blue Trail Software to create a new ‘Looking Glass’ experience available in very few selected stores around the globe. The new technology offers customers to try on rings that might be ‘out of stock’ or your favourite ring from your wish list is not available in your size or you are one of the special customers who wish to have their ring made with custom adjustments. Basically, no matter your problem, AR technology is now the perfect addition to the luxury brand, offering customers a unique and entertaining experience, which might be the future of retail shopping.

diesel partnership with hape nft

Fashion brand Diesel announces the launch of a non-fungible token (NFT) collection in partnership with a blockchain startup called HAPE. Diesel’s creative director Glenn Martens and HAPE start-up creator Digimental, co-created the NFTs which will offer you physical and also digital value. The benefits of the digital collectible will offer 1DR POD crossbody bag with additional exclusive benefits which include access to private events and community benefits. Additionally, Diesel also launched a NFT digital and physical wearables platform called D:VERSE, bringing luxury digital wearables to the Metaverse. Diesel is constantly making sure that virtual reality is the future of the fashion industry.

The Diamond tiffany & Co. cryptopunk nft necklace

CryptoPunk holders who own $50,000 (30 Ethereum), can receive a handcrafted pendant that is designed after their virtual NFT. Tiffany & Co. created a unique pendant made out of 30 diamonds, hanging on an 18K golden chain which features five diamonds on the clasp. Tiffany renames the collection to ‘NFTiff.’ The collection is extremely limited with Tiffany selling 250 NFTiffs, however, these can be redeemed once you own a CryptoPunk.
